> The goal of this project is to complete the implementation of the DOM Level 3 
> LSParser. Though Xerces has a functional LSParser, there are a couple parts 
> of the spec which still need to be implemented. This includes an asynchronous 
> [1] version which returns from the parse method immediately and builds the 
> DOM tree on another thread as well as parseWithContext [2] which allows a 
> document fragment to be parsed and attached to an existing DOM.
